admin 管理员组

文章数量: 1086019


2024年1月22日发(作者:阶乘函数matlab)

MySQL数据导入与导出方法

MySQL是一种关系型数据库管理系统,被广泛应用于各种类型的应用程序中。在实际开发中,经常会遇到需要将数据导入或导出到MySQL数据库的情况。本文将以多个方面介绍MySQL数据导入与导出的方法。

一、导入数据方法

1. 使用MySQL命令行导入数据

MySQL命令行是MySQL自带的一个交互式工具,可以通过命令行直接执行SQL语句。要导入数据,首先需要确保你已经创建好了要导入数据的数据库和表。然后,使用以下命令导入数据:

```shell

mysql -u username -p database_name < data_

```

其中,`username`是你的MySQL用户名,`database_name`是要导入数据的数据库名,`data_`是包含要导入数据的SQL文件。执行这个命令后,系统会提示你输入MySQL密码,输入正确的密码后,数据就会被导入到指定的数据库中。

2. 使用MySQL Workbench导入数据

MySQL Workbench是MySQL官方提供的一款GUI工具,可以方便地管理和操作MySQL数据库。要使用MySQL Workbench导入数据,首先打开MySQL

Workbench,并连接到目标数据库。然后,选择要导入数据的数据库,点击"Server"菜单,选择"Data Import"选项。

在弹出的对话框中,选择合适的导入方式,如"Import from Self-Contained File"或"Import from Dump Project Folder"等。然后,选择要导入的SQL文件或目录,并点击"Start Import"按钮,系统会自动导入数据到指定的数据库。

3. 使用Navicat导入数据

Navicat是一款流行的MySQL数据库管理工具,除了提供基本的数据库管理功能外,还支持数据导入功能。要使用Navicat导入数据,首先打开Navicat,并连接到目标数据库。然后,在导航栏选择目标数据库,右键点击鼠标,选择"导入向导"选项。

在弹出的导入向导对话框中,选择要导入的数据源(可以是SQL文件或其他数据库),并设置相关的导入选项,如字符集和表结构等。然后,点击"下一步"按钮,系统会开始导入数据到指定的数据库。

二、导出数据方法

1. 使用MySQL命令行导出数据

要使用MySQL命令行导出数据,首先需要登录到MySQL命令行。然后,使用以下命令导出数据:

```shell

mysqldump -u username -p database_name > data_

```

其中,`username`是你的MySQL用户名,`database_name`是要导出数据的数据库名,`data_`是导出数据的SQL文件名。执行这个命令后,系统会提示你输入MySQL密码,输入正确的密码后,数据就会被导出到指定的SQL文件中。

2. 使用MySQL Workbench导出数据

要使用MySQL Workbench导出数据,首先打开MySQL Workbench,并连接到目标数据库。然后,选择要导出数据的数据库,点击"Server"菜单,选择"Data

Export"选项。

在弹出的对话框中,选择要导出的对象(可以是数据库、表或查询结果等),设置相关的导出选项,如导出文件的格式(如SQL、CSV等)、字符集和导出数据的范围等。然后,点击"Start Export"按钮,系统会自动导出数据到指定的文件中。

3. 使用Navicat导出数据

要使用Navicat导出数据,首先打开Navicat,并连接到目标数据库。然后,在导航栏选择目标数据库,右键点击鼠标,选择"备份向导"选项。

在弹出的备份向导对话框中,选择要备份的数据表,设置相关的备份选项,如备份文件的格式(如SQL、CSV等)、字符集和备份数据的范围等。然后,点击"下一步"按钮,系统会开始备份数据,并将备份文件保存在指定的位置。

结论:

本文分别介绍了使用MySQL命令行、MySQL Workbench和Navicat进行数据导入和导出的方法。无论是通过命令行还是GUI工具,都可以方便地实现数据的导入和导出操作。根据实际需求和个人喜好,选择合适的工具和方法进行操作即可。希望本文对于学习和掌握MySQL数据导入与导出方法有所帮助。


本文标签: 数据 导入 导出 数据库